Transaction 81b17463d6097ef48d8c5e359fd2577c527f72b0c7f5b70ba983233a439be6ea
1 Input
1 Output
-
81b17463d6097ef48d8c5e359fd2577c527f72b0c7f5b70ba983233a439be6ea:0
- value
- 10673570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6f05c11488840d26ab3b2f6e2883b499d4c2efc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K8tjTrCU7mbcr5JWEsJarzKsFKQYGWsBe